Q* Rumors Highlight AI's Struggle With Step-by-Step Reasoning

Recent rumors about OpenAI's mysterious Q* project point to a real and significant area of AI research: teaching models to solve grade-school math. While unlikely to pose an existential threat, this breakthrough represents an important step toward general reasoning abilities.

Rumors swirl around OpenAI's mysterious Q* project following the brief ousting of CEO Sam Altman, with reports suggesting the model solves previously unseen math problems at a grade-school level. While some early reports linked this supposed breakthrough to dire warnings about humanity's safety, subsequent journalism fails to confirm these dramatic claims. OpenAI keeps the exact details of Q* under wraps, but the company openly publishes research about its ongoing efforts to improve AI mathematical capabilities.

Teaching artificial intelligence to solve basic math represents a major challenge because it requires step-by-step reasoning rather than simple pattern matching. Current large language models struggle with novel math problems since they cannot rely on memorized training data to find the correct answer. By developing systems that logically work through mathematical equations one step at a time, researchers aim to build foundational skills that extend far beyond simple arithmetic.

Experts outside of OpenAI, including teams at Google's DeepMind, actively explore these same reasoning techniques to improve AI performance. The author remains highly skeptical that Q* serves as the ultimate key to artificial general intelligence or poses any threat to humanity. However, mastering grade-school math provides a crucial benchmark for AI, as the underlying step-by-step logic translates directly to broader, more complex problem-solving tasks.
